Advanced Wearable Peripheral Stimulation Device Manufacturing

Decoding and Modulating Neural Signals: The Neuro-AI Edge

Traditional peripheral stimulators rely on static, open-loop pulse outputs. Next-generation Turkish factories are integrating bioelectronic breakthroughs that listen to the peripheral nervous system and adjust stimulation parameters dynamically in real time.

01. High-Fidelity Signal Decoding (SENSE)

Multi-channel surface EMG and nerve signal sensors capture subtle peripheral motor signatures. Advanced digital filtering separates physiological tremor patterns from intentional movement, eliminating signal noise with microscopic precision.

02. Cloud-Based Neural AI (DECIDE)

Embedded processors transmit digitized neural signatures to cloud-based neural networks. AI algorithms map individual tremor fingerprints and calculate ideal burst patterns, pulse widths, and phase shifts tailored to the user's immediate state.

03. Targeted Nerve Modulation (TREAT)

Calibrated transcutaneous electrical or mechanical peripheral nerve stimulation (PNS) is delivered directly to afferent neural pathways (such as radial and median nerves), interrupting pathological tremor loops without requiring surgery or pharmacological intervention.

Duty-Free Customs & Logistics

Leveraging the EU-Turkey Customs Union, goods shipped from Turkish ports enjoy tariff-free entry into European Union member states, reducing overall landed procurement costs by up to 25%.

What documentation is required for importing micro-tremor seismographs from Turkey?

Exporting geotechnical instruments requires an ATR Movement Certificate (for duty-free EU entry), Commercial Invoice, Packing List, Certificate of Origin, and ISO 17025 Calibration Reports. Turkish exporters handle full customs clearing documentation at point of exit.
